Transaction 5aabd8049b391c0a22100adeac517c68ca0a49347cd28f4d9ccede9f9674839f

40 Input
2 Outputs
  • 5aabd8049b391c0a22100adeac517c68ca0a49347cd28f4d9ccede9f9674839f:0
  • value  22990376
    address  bc1q3ptk98wz7lctsyym3x47u4q4ngp32g6mjvs8ak7a8t8sataa0fcqsnwh84
  • 5aabd8049b391c0a22100adeac517c68ca0a49347cd28f4d9ccede9f9674839f:1
  • value  500000000
    address  1Ka4Ddbepeuj6LacQz1Gg9J4iisQFzNZ43